- W71604965 abstract "In this paper we describe how UML schemes can be converted into OWL Ontology, thus enabling reasoning on them by Semantic Web applications. The proposed solution is based on a three phases approach, the first step is to present the class diagram in the mathematical formulation and the second one is converting the UML Class into encoded text file, finally, the structure of the classification scheme is converted into OWL ontology. We demonstrate the practical applicability of our approach by showing how the results of reasoning on these OWL ontology can help improve the Web systems. The OWL Web Ontology Language [2] is designed for use by applications that need to process the content of information instead of just presenting information to humans. The use of ontology Web is growing rapidly since the emergence of the Semantic Web. Most of the data is still modeled and stored in relational databases / objects and therefore out of reach for many applications of the Semantic Web. A critical requirement for the evolution of the current Web of documents into a Web of Data is the inclusion of the vast quantities of data stored in Relational Databases (RDB). The mapping of these vast quantities of data from RDB to the Resource Description Framework (RDF) has been the focus of a large body of research work in diverse domains. Some of the most notable approaches of this kind are R2O [3], D2RQ [4], Virtuoso RDF Views [5, 6] and DartGrid [7]. The R2O approach defines declarative and extensible language (in xml) to describe mapping between given RDB and an OWL ontology or RDFS schema so that tools can process this mapping and generate triples that correspond to source RDB data. G.Bumans et al [8] demonstrate a very simple standard SQLbased RDB to RDF/OWL mapping approach that is based on defining correspondence between the tables of the database and the classes of the ontology, as well as between table fields/links in the database and datatype/object properties in the ontology. UML models cannot be easily exchanged over the Web, the reasoning possibilities with UML models being also quite restricted. [9] and [10] propose a simples transformations between UML and ontology representation languages. Recently, some efforts arose in bringing together UML and the Semantic Web. Nevertheless, most of these approaches do not use all proprieties of the UML diagrams as a data source. In this direction several researches are underway to transform data into Web semantic (XML/RDF/OWL). J. Fong et al [11] proposes a method for Converting relational database into XML data with DOM. Wu and Hsieh [12] used a technique for mapping UML to XML. They created XSD from class diagrams, but this technique is very complex to generate the XSD file for each class diagram. In our previous work [13], we have developed a Framework for converting a class diagram into an XML document and show how to use Web files for the design of data based on the classification UML. Our approach for mapping is based on several steps. First step is to formulate the class diagram into a mathematical structure and transform it into an encoded text file (Section II).
